The Story of Mary and Martha: A Lesson on Rest and Priorities
In Luke 10:38-42, Jesus visits the home of Mary and Martha. While Martha busies herself with preparations, Mary sits at Jesus’ feet and listens to His teaching. When Martha complains to Jesus that Mary isn’t helping, Jesus responds, “Martha, Martha, you are worried and upset about many things, but few things are needed—or indeed only one. Mary has chosen what is better, and it will not be taken away from her.” This story illustrates the importance of prioritizing rest and time spent with God over the busyness of life.
The Importance of Rest
- Physical Health – Rest is essential for our physical health. It allows our bodies to recover and recharge, reducing the risk of burnout and illness. It’s essential to prioritize sleep, exercise, and relaxation time to maintain our physical health.
- Mental Health – Rest is also crucial for our mental health. Chronic stress and busyness can lead to anxiety, depression, and other mental health issues. Taking time to relax, meditate, and practice self-care can help to reduce stress and promote mental well-being.
- Spiritual Health – Rest is also essential for our spiritual health. It allows us to connect with God, hear His voice, and renew our faith. Time spent in prayer, reading the Bible, and attending church can help us to deepen our relationship with God and find rest for our souls.
